The Nissan E13 uses a rubber timing belt to synchronize the crankshaft and camshaft. Because this is an interference engine design, a snapped belt will cause the pistons to strike and ruin the valves.

It's important to address a common point of confusion. Modern Nissan models like the (introduced around 2020) use a completely different engine: the HR12DE . This is a 1.2-liter, 3-cylinder, DOHC engine that is part of Nissan's e-POWER hybrid system. In this setup, the petrol engine acts solely as a generator for the electric motor that drives the wheels. nissan e13 engine service manual

The engine serial number is stamped directly onto the cylinder block. You can find it on the front right side of the engine block near the flywheel housing. Match this number with your chassis plate to ensure you are referencing the correct manual variation. 2. Routine Maintenance and Adjustments

Unlike modern engines with hydraulic lifters, the E13 uses manual mechanical adjusters. You must check and adjust the valve clearance every 20,000 km to prevent power loss or burnt valves.
